The Healing Power of Moisture: Why Wet Compresses Are Your New Best Friend
After getting your brows tattooed, the area can feel tender and swollen. This is where wet compresses come in like a soothing balm. By applying a cool, damp cloth to the treated area, you’re not only reducing inflammation and swelling but also promoting faster healing. Think of it as a spa treatment for your newly inked brows. 🧖♀️💧
The moisture from the compress helps keep the skin hydrated, which is crucial during the healing process. Dryness can lead to itching and peeling, which might disrupt the healing process and affect the final appearance of your tattoo. So, grab that washcloth and let’s get to work!
Step-by-Step Guide: How to Apply a Wet Compress Like a Pro
Applying a wet compress is straightforward, but there are some key steps to follow for maximum benefit:
- Use clean, cold water to dampen a soft cloth.
- Gently press the cloth onto the treated area for 10-15 minutes at a time.
- Avoid rubbing or pressing too hard, as this can irritate the skin further.
- Repeat this process several times a day, especially during the first few days post-tattoo.
Remember, consistency is key. Regular application of wet compresses will help soothe any discomfort and speed up the healing process. Plus, it’s a great excuse to take a little me-time and relax. 😌
Beyond Wet Compresses: Additional Tips for Optimal Brow Tattoo Recovery
While wet compresses are a cornerstone of post-brow tattoo care, there are other steps you can take to ensure your brows heal beautifully:
- Keep it Clean: Gently wash the area with mild soap and lukewarm water, avoiding harsh products that could irritate the skin.
- Protect from Sun: UV rays can fade your tattoo over time, so make sure to use sunscreen or cover the area when going outdoors.
- Stay Hydrated: Drink plenty of water to keep your skin hydrated from the inside out.
- Avoid Scratching: Resist the urge to scratch or peel, as this can damage the tattoo and prolong the healing process.
